如何选择一个没有任何属性并包含Jsoup特定子项的div?

时间:2015-11-01 07:22:14

标签: jsoup

我想选择以下的html。 div没有任何属性,包含img和一个孩子。提前谢谢。

<div>
  date:
 <img src="http:XXXXX" hspace="2" vspace="0"> 
 <a href="/xxxxx/xxxxx/xxxxx/">today</a> 
 <img src="http:XXXXX" hspace="2" vspace="0">
 <a href="/xxxxx/xxxxx/xxxxx/20151102/"> 11/02 </a> 
 <img src="http:XXXXX" hspace="2" vspace="0">
 <a href="/xxxxx/xxxxx/xxxxx/20151103/"> 11/03 </a>      
</div>

1 个答案:

答案 0 :(得分:0)

希望它会对你有所帮助。

Elements elements = doc.select("div");

for(Element element : elements){

    if(element.attributes().size() > 0 || element.select("img").size() == 0){

        elements.remove(element);

    }   
}